Citadel Securities is increasingly constructive on U.S. equities heading into the final quarter, viewing the recent artificial intelligence sell-off as a risk-release event that sets up a year-end rally. Scott Rubner, head of equity and derivatives strategy, advises investors to use any persistent market weakness through month-end as an opportunity to re-add exposure to core sectors.
While short-term volatility and potential declines may continue over the next two weeks due to unfavorable supply-demand dynamics and technical headwinds, sentiment is expected to reverse starting in October. The recovery is projected to begin in tech stocks before spreading to the broader market as negative positioning in AI-related assets normalizes.
